Output 1d69a1c8eb968ca2ceaeb1b6f737aab58bea7cb8500df3f5052c1dab5c428af7:2

value
21417438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4c81e668390fa41398631ab071339563094de2 OP_EQUAL
address
3EPZW36uPy6QM48ycFbnsAq8QkpfbmbfYd
transaction
1d69a1c8eb968ca2ceaeb1b6f737aab58bea7cb8500df3f5052c1dab5c428af7
confirmations
201781
spent
true